HERITAGE WEEK 2020
The Heritage Council is putting a callout for project ideas for National Heritage Week 2020. National Heritage Week, will run from Saturday, 15th Sunday, August 23. This year, instead of events, the Heritage Council are looking for projects from individuals and groups all around the country that explore the theme of ‘Learning from our Heritage’. To help you to choose a topic, three sub-themes are suggested Heritage on your doorstep, relearning skills from our heritage and the heritage of education. JM SYNGE
Local theatre maker Cliona O’Connell, and Aughrim based actress Andrea Kelly would love to talk to people in the area who have local knowledge or stories about the playwright JM Synge, the Synge family and their connection to the Roundwood area. Any information you have, no matter how small, is very welcome. We are currently working on the development of a new theatre project sited in the county, re-imagining Synge’s life, work and connection to Wicklow. This project is funded under the Wicklow Artist Award Scheme 2020.
